Personal mortgage insurance (PMI) protects the lending institution in case you default on your mortgage payments and your house isn't worth enough to entirely repay the lender through a foreclosure sale. Regrettably, you foot the costs for the premiums, and loan providers usually require PMI for loans where the deposit is less than 20%. They include the expense to your home loan payment every month, in a quantity based on how much you have actually borrowed. The great news is that PMI can generally be canceled after your home's worth has increased enough to provide you 20% to 25% equity in your house.

The Act states that you can ask that your PMI be canceled when you have actually paid for your mortgage to 80% of the loan, if you have a great record of payment and compliance with the regards to your home loan, you make a written request, and you show that the value of the home hasn't decreased, nor have you encumbered it with liens (such as a 2nd home mortgage). If you fulfill all these conditions, the lender needs to grant your request to cancel the PMI. What's more, when you have actually paid down your mortgage to 78% of the initial loan, the law states that the lender must instantly cancel your PMI.

Regrettably, it may take years to get to this point. Thanks to the marvels of amortization, your schedule of payments is front-loaded so that you're primarily settling the interest in the beginning. Even if you haven't paid for your home loan to among these legal limits, you can begin trying to get your PMI canceled as quickly as you presume that your equity in your house or your home's value has actually increased significantly, perhaps due to the fact that your house's value has risen together with other regional homes or since you've remodeled. Such value-based increases in equity are more difficult to show to your loan provider, and some lending institutions require you to wait a minimum time (around two years) before they will approve cancellation of PMI on this basis.

Your lender might require an appraisal even if you're requesting a cancellation based upon your many payments, because the loan provider needs reassurance that the home hasn't decreased in value. Although you'll normally pay the appraiser's costs, it's finest to utilize an appraiser whom your lending institution recommends and whose findings the loan provider will therefore respect. (Note: Your tax evaluation might reveal a completely different worth from the appraiser's-- do not be worried, tax assessments frequently lag behind, and the tax assessor won't see the appraiser's report, thank goodness.) 8, or 80%. Most lending institutions require that your LTV ratio be 80% or lower before they will cancel your PMI. Keep in mind: Some loan providers reveal the percentage in reverse, requiring at least 20% equity in the residential or commercial property, for example. When your LTV ratio reaches 78% based upon the original value of your home, keep in mind that the House owners' Security Act may need your lending institution to cancel your PMI without your asking. If the loan to worth ratio is at the portion needed by your lending institution, follow the loan provider's stated procedures for asking for a PMI cancellation. Anticipate to have to compose another letter with your request, mentioning your home's existing worth and your remaining financial obligation amount, and consisting of a copy of the appraisal report.

Nonetheless, lots of home buyers find their loan providers to be frustratingly sluggish to awaken and cancel the protection. The reality that they'll need to hang out reviewing your apply for no instant gain which the insurer might also drag its feet are most likely contributing aspects. If your lending institution refuses, or is slow to act on your PMI cancellation demand, compose courteous however firm letters asking for action. What percentage do real estate agents make. Such letters are very important not only to prod the loan provider into movement, however to function as evidence if you're later on forced to take the loan provider to court. You can likewise send a grievance online to the Consumer Financing Security Bureau (CFPB).
